  • The STACC (Safety and Technical Assistance for Alabama Cities and Counties) grant provides a mechanism by

which local governments can request technical assistance to address highway safety concerns at specific locations or corridors on locally maintained roadways in their jurisdictions. Such assistance can include, but is not limited to, network screening, diagnosing safety problems, recommending countermeasures, and supporting road safety reviews.
